How To Fix F2552 - Communication type &1 requires at least one entry (required entry field)


F2552 - Overview

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: F2 - Master Data Maintenance: Customer, Vendor

  • Message number: 552

  • Message text: Communication type &1 requires at least one entry (required entry field)

    The SAP error message F2552, which states "Communication type &1 requires at least one entry (required entry field)," typically occurs in the context of maintaining communication data for business partners, customers, or vendors in the SAP system. This error indicates that a required field for a specific communication type (like email, phone number, etc.) has not been filled out.
    
    Cause: Missing Required Fields: The communication type you are trying to maintain (e.g., email, phone) requires at least one entry, but none has been provided. Incorrect Configuration: The communication type may be incorrectly configured in the system, leading to the requirement of an entry that is not being met. Data Entry Error: There may have been an oversight during data entry, where the user did not fill in the necessary fields.
